I'm very happy to report.... MN finally woke up and is now offering a STATE WIDE youth deer hunt! MN had a youth season, but it was only in the NW and SE part of the sate.

Please don't take this the wrong way, I'm not at all trying to say this happened because of my constant bitching to the DNR. I was not on the committee. Just respectfully voiced my concerns and comments to them.

Maybe some of you remember me posting about this a few years ago. The lack of a decent youth deer season here in MN is what led me to take our kids to other more youth friendly states to hunt. SD and WI have great programs for kids. I have had phone calls, conference calls, and emails for 2 years to various members of the MNDNR, MDHA, and 2 differnt MN Big Game Program Leaders, voicing and writing several letters and essays with my concerns, comments, and general bitching. The most important one of all...they were getting hit in the pocket book by neighboring states with great youth programs.

MN DNR put together a Deer Committee to work on the MN Deer Management Plan for the next 10 years. One of the big things tackled by the committee was the youth deer hunt. I talked with Adam Murkowski at the beginning a few years ago and Barb Keller this winter. They were both very willing to listen, and talk to me about it. 2 years ago, Adam Murkowski scheduled time to for an actual phone call after we emailed back and forth about 5 times. He and I talked about it for almost 1.5 hours.

The sad thing is, the biggest "kick back" was from fellow hunters. The "good old boys club" of hunters that would say "we had to wait until deer season when we were kids, so do they." Piss poor attitude and irritating.

The studies finally showed how minimal a early youth season actually was to the deer population and not taking any of "their" deer away.

Since I've done my fair share and probably more than my fair share of whining and bitching to and about the MN DNR, I'll give them the "atta boy" for getting something right as well.
